Output 9039683d20a471c5161eaefb8f49963aaeec30016f2f1d93e278a8a8f3605951:1

value
11552013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e466a5030ad83574062f1c9792a7961c5961cfd3 OP_EQUAL
address
MUiqG39SwDJ8qUAnuZyLCfPDAhVh6twW7G
transaction
9039683d20a471c5161eaefb8f49963aaeec30016f2f1d93e278a8a8f3605951
spent
true